Pupa Beetle (プーパビートル) is a rhino beetle-type Medarot that only appears in Medarot Navi.

Description[edit]

Unlike every other entry in the KBT series, Pupa Beetle doesn't much resemble a rhinoceros beetle or a Medabot at all; rather, its Head part is a glowing orange bundle of energy. Each Arm appears to be a beetle larva and its Legs are simply more energy. Its attacks are identical to those of others in the KBT series - Missile head, Rifle arm and Gatling arm - but are fairly weak compared to Kantaros or Saikachis.

Things change greatly when Power Medachange enters the picture. Energy becomes matter and weak becomes strong as a miniature Granbeetle is born. Its Missile is replaced with Scope, passively giving it perfect accuracy while stationary, and its Rifle and Gatling are given much greater strength.

The requirements for Medachange are their weakness - strip them of a part before they can grow into a serious threat.

In the games[edit]

In Medarot Navi[edit]

Pupa Beetles, along with their Pupa Stag buddies, appear in great numbers in the game's final chapter alongside the five Fossil Medarots: Mono-Cruziana, Di-Tyranno, Tri-Ptera, Quar-Brachio and Zero-Suicide. They also share some of the fossils' aesthetic, particularly the striping on their arm cannons.

Of note is that Pupa Beetle shares the same model number as Granbeetle. Could this be more than coincidence?
